Staff Cybersecurity Systems Engineer (Level 5) - R10221573-7

Northrop Grumman is a trusted provider of mission-enabling solutions for global security, and they are seeking a Staff Cybersecurity Systems Engineer to support the Sentinel program. The role involves ensuring cybersecurity attributes are implemented in system designs and guiding the development of cybersecurity protections and risk management.

Responsibilities

Author and review requirement decomposition, derivation, and flow down
Implement and review traceability of requirements throughout a spec tree architecture
Support the architecture and design of baked in cybersecurity requirements and protections
Document and review traceability of requirements to the design & its models
Implement and review the application of cybersecurity profile stereotypes to a Model Based System Engineering (MBSE) Architecture
Provide cybersecurity system engineering implementation guidance and oversight to technical teams/implementers
Review and Assess stakeholder security objectives, protection needs and concerns, security requirements, and associated verification/validation methods
Implement, review and assess cybersecurity system requirements verification/validation methods
Identify and/or assess vulnerabilities and susceptibility to life cycle disruptions, hazards, and threats
Provide security considerations to inform systems engineering efforts with the objective to reduce errors, flaws, and weakness that may constitute security vulnerability leading to unacceptable asset loss and consequences
Identify, quantify, and evaluate the costs/benefits of security functions and considerations to inform analysis of alternatives, engineering trade-offs, and risk treatment decisions
Author, support and maintain cybersecurity program documentation & RMF package documentation: Cybersecurity Strategies, System Security Plans, Continuous Monitoring Plans, Risk Assessment Report, Security Control Traceability Matrix, Plan Of Actions & Milestones, etc
